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ria: Patients older than 18 years old; good general health; do not present enamel erosion, dental abfraction, caries or periodontal disease; do not use orthodontic appliance or removable prostheses; present all teeth - First Molar to First Molar (Upper and Lower); avaiability of recurring returns; absence of gingival recession; submitted to bleaching for minimum period of 2 years.

Exclusion criteria

Exclusion criteria: Chemically dependent patients, nonsmokers and alcoholic ; medical condition that may interefere in patients' security during the study: use of drug therapy to chronic disease or allergic reaction to substances that will be used; pregnancy; participate of another study in the same time; presenting restorations in the six anterior teeth of each arch; frequent use of fluoride supplementation or desensitization substances; bruxism; periapical lesions; tooth sensitivity.

Design outcomes

Primary

MeasureTime frame
Expected outcome 1: The hydrogen peroxide degradation will be higher in upper trays than lower trays verified by sodium permanganate titration of bleaching gel, considering 50% of degradation in the first hour of use in the end of the study;Expected outcome 2: The presence of peroxide in saliva will be higher in prefilled trays than customized trays determined by 4-aminoantipirin reaction with saliva by analytical spectrophometer since the minimum presence of 0.26mg/kg in the end of the study
